The 2000 UEFA Cup Final Riots, also known as the Battle of Copenhagen,[1] were a series of riots in City Hall Square, Copenhagen, Denmark between fans of English football team Arsenal and Turkish team Galatasaray around the 2000 UEFA Cup Final on 17 May 2000. In May 2002 Demir, who admitted the stabbings, was sentenced to 15 years in prison with four other men imprisoned for three months each. [20], After the match, which Galatasaray won 41 on penalties, approximately 300 Arsenal fans in the Finsbury Park area of Islington in London attacked Turkish restaurants and businesses, with bottles being used to break windows. Four people were stabbed in the scuffles, which also involved fans from other clubs and were viewed by the media as part of a retaliation for the killing of two Leeds United fans by Galatasaray supporters the month before. Later in the evening, a group of around 20 Leeds supporters broke off and found their way to the Riddim bar near Taksim Square, the huge expanse in the centre of Istanbul which was filled with places to eat and drink. Christopher Loftus and Kevin Speight were stabbed during street clashes the night before Leeds played Turkey's Galatasaray in the second leg of the Uefa Cup semi-finals in April 2000.
